95 viewsIn a significant step towards strengthening social welfare and promoting independent mobility, the Uttar Pradesh government has announced free travel in UPSRTC (Uttar Pradesh State Road Transport Corporation) buses for women aged 60 years and above. The initiative aims to reduce travel expenses for senior women while ensuring easier access to healthcare, religious places, family visits, and other essential services.
Under the new scheme, eligible women will be able to travel free of cost on state-run roadways buses after completing the prescribed verification process. The government is expected to issue detailed operational guidelines regarding identity verification and ticket issuance before the scheme is fully implemented.
